Web28 dec. 2024 · Here are a few of the main benefits of IoT for healthcare: Remote Monitoring Patients can be fitted with IoT health monitors such as connected pacemakers, insulin pumps, or heart monitors to help manage chronic diseases. From afar, doctors can monitor their patients’ data and receive alerts if something appears to be wrong.

WebThe CDC reports that, as of 2015, approximately 10% of the US population was already diabetic and an additional 26% was at risk of developing diabetes within 5 years. The US population is about 330 million, so that means that approximately 118 million people in the country are either diabetic or prediabetic. Developed by U.S. company Senseonics and distributed by Ascensia Diabetes Care, Eversense is a subcutaneous implant that continuously monitors blood glucose levels.
